IT Systems Administrator- EM257
Overall Purpose of Role:
EasyMarkets, an international financial company headquartered in Cyprus, is seeking to recruit an IT Systems Administrator to join our IT Team. The successful candidate will be responsible for maintaining the Company’s IT systems (software, hardware, communication), and assisting internal users with their IT requests and issues.
Depending on experience, the successful candidate will also be expected to initiate and undertake IT Projects, participate in the management of IT Security, and have responsibilities including Administrating Active Directory, Domains and Office 365.
Main Activities and Responsibilities
- Undertake maintenance of IT systems as prioritized
- Provide approachable and professional IT Support to internal users, both locally and overseas
- IT Service Desk duties, including the resolution of issues; the management of Office hardware; Leavers & Joiner processing etc.
- Maintain critical Technology systems such as email, Domains, Telephony, the LAN, Wi-Fi, PCs, Laptops, Printers, backups, local servers
- Analysis, Comparison and Purchases of IT Equipment and IT related services
- Ensure that all telecommunication systems are always functioning
- Participate in ongoing activities to enhance the IT Infrastructure of easyMarkets
- Participate in the management of the Generators and UPS and dealing with the Electricity Authority when required
- Identify, propose, and implement improvements to systems, procedures, and services
Other Responsibilities
- Participate in the Administration of the Active Directory, Domain and Office 365 environments, in addition to third party on premises and SaaS Applications
- Lead and collaborate on projects to enhance the operating environment and IT Security
- Actively participate in the monitoring and enforcement of IT Security Policies and the management of Security Systems
- Assist with gathering evidence for IT Audits, and periodical reviews related to the governance of the IT Systems, User Accounts, and Access
Main requirements:
- Diploma in Computer Science or Computer Engineering or equivalent
- 2-3 years of experience including working as a Service Desk Technician
- Ability to troubleshoot in a Windows / MAC (system & end client)
- Administer and manage Antivirus Console
- Administer and manage WDS/MDT Server
- Basic network experience with switches and VLANS
- Experience with Active Directory and knowledge AzureAD managing GPOS, DNS, DHCP
- A desire to learn by proactive self-study and via mentoring from senior colleagues
- Knowledge of monitoring system solutions
- Unquestionable integrity and honesty
- A can-do attitude and willingness to support the team in all aspects of the role
Beneficial Experience
- 1-2 years of experience working as an IT System Administrator in a Microsoft heavy environment
- Experience managing Windows Servers in an Enterprise environment
- Telephony management experience (PBX, DID, Trunking)
- Practical experience managing, (and ideally in integrating), IT Security tools and systems
- Knowledge of Firewall administration and Networking
- Experience in administrating cloud and hybrid environments (O365 AzureAD)
- Ability to troubleshoot Linux (system & end client)
